在Web应用程序项目中引用app_code类

时间:2011-11-05 00:04:28

标签: asp.net app-code add-references-dialog

我创建了一个asp.net网站,附带了app_code文件夹。

在同一个解决方案中,我添加了一个Web应用程序项目,我想使用网站app_code文件夹中的类。

我尝试添加引用,然后添加项目(网站),但项目列表为空... 感谢。

2 个答案:

答案 0 :(得分:6)

你做错了。创建一个类库项目,并将所有这些类从app_code文件夹移动到新项目。然后从网站和Web应用程序项目中引用该项目。

答案 1 :(得分:2)

很晚,但有时App_Code中的类可能需要保留在同一个项目中,然后

  1. 在Web应用程序中创建一个新文件夹(比如“代码”),并从app_code添加类文件作为此文件夹的链接。这使您可以拥有一个副本。
  2. 2)如果需要,确保每个导入文件的Build Action都在文件属性文件夹中“Compile”。

    3)从Web应用程序中排除App_Code文件夹。

    更多信息和原因 - 请参见此处:

    http://vishaljoshi.blogspot.in/2009/07/appcode-folder-doesnt-work-with-web.html